    Anesthesiology Opening - Tulsa, Oklahoma Monday-Friday Schedule Minimal Call Up to $400K + Loan Repayment A leading integrated healthcare system in Tulsa, Oklahoma is seeking a Board Eligible/Board Certified Anesthesiologist to join a collaborative and mission-driven team providing high-quality perioperative care across inpatient and outpatient settings. This is an excellent opportunity for physicians seeking strong clinical support, outstanding work-life balance, minimal call responsibilities, and long-term stability within a highly respected healthcare environment. Position Highlights Monday-Friday schedule: 7:00 AM - 3:30 PM Minimal on-call coverage Stable, well-supported anesthesia team Collaborative perioperative environment Opportunity to mentor CRNAs and medical trainees Strong administrative and nursing support Meaningful impact on patient access and continuity of care Compensation & Benefits Compensation $325,000 - $400,000 base salary Additional incentives available Potential recruitment, relocation, and retention bonuses Outstanding Benefits Package Up to $200,000 in student loan repayment assistance 50-55 days paid time off annually Federal retirement pension + 401(k) with matching contributions Comprehensive medical, dental, vision, and life insurance Paid CME + CME reimbursement Malpractice coverage with tail included No restrictive non-compete Moonlighting permitted Responsibilities Perform comprehensive pre-anesthesia evaluations and develop individualized anesthesia care plans Provide anesthesia services including: General anesthesia Regional anesthesia Spinal and epidural anesthesia Monitored anesthesia care (MAC) Manage routine and complex airway cases, including emergent airway situations Place arterial lines and central venous catheters as clinically indicated Supervise and collaborate with CRNAs and anesthesia staff Participate in perioperative workflow improvement and quality initiatives Maintain accurate and timely EMR documentation Qualifications MD or DO from an accredited medical school Completion of an approved Anesthesiology residency program Board Eligible or Board Certified in Anesthesiology Active, unrestricted U.S. medical license Experience with a broad range of anesthesia modalities Strong airway management and perioperative care skills Preferred Experience Hospital-based or integrated healthcare system experience CRNA supervision experience Advanced airway techniques including fiberoptic intubation Teaching or mentoring experience Perioperative workflow optimization initiatives Location Tulsa offers an exceptional quality of life with: Affordable cost of living Family-friendly communities Excellent dining, arts, and outdoor recreation Easy access to lakes, parks, and cultural attractions If you are interested in learning more about this Anesthesiology opportunity in Tulsa, Oklahoma, please apply today for confidential consideration.
